Leveraging Statistical Modeling for Enhanced Prediction

Statistical modeling forms the backbone of many sophisticated strategies. Techniques like regression analysis, Bayesian statistics, and time series analysis are employed to identify patterns and relationships within datasets and create predictive models. Regression analysis, for example, can be used to determine how different variables influence a particular outcome. Bayesian statistics allows for the incorporation of prior beliefs and updating them based on new evidence. Time series analysis is useful for forecasting future values based on historical data. The choice of statistical model depends on the nature of the data and the specific objective of the analysis.

However, it's important to remember that statistical models are simplifications of reality. They are based on assumptions, and these assumptions may not always hold true. Model validation is a crucial step in the process, involving testing the model's performance on independent datasets to assess its accuracy and generalizability. Overfitting, where a model performs well on the training data but poorly on new data, is a common problem that must be addressed through techniques like regularization and cross-validation. A robust model should be able to accurately predict outcomes on unseen data.

The Importance of Model Backtesting and Refinement

Model backtesting is the process of evaluating a model's performance on historical data to simulate how it would have performed in the past. This allows for assessing the model's profitability and identifying areas for improvement. Backtesting should be conducted using realistic assumptions and transaction costs to accurately reflect real-world performance. It’s crucial to avoid look-ahead bias, where the model uses information that would not have been available at the time the prediction was made. Thorough backtesting provides valuable insights into a model’s strengths and weaknesses, enabling targeted refinement.

Model refinement is an iterative process that involves adjusting the model's parameters, adding new variables, or changing the underlying statistical technique to improve its performance. This process often requires a deep understanding of the domain being analyzed and a willingness to experiment. A continuous cycle of backtesting and refinement is essential for maintaining a competitive edge in a dynamic environment. The best models are not static; they evolve over time as new data becomes available and the underlying dynamics of the system change.

Implementing a Robust Staking Plan

A staking plan outlines how much capital to allocate to each prediction. A conservative staking plan might allocate a small percentage of the total bankroll to each prediction, while an aggressive staking plan might allocate a larger percentage. The choice of staking plan depends on the investor's risk tolerance and confidence in the predictive model. The Kelly criterion is a mathematical formula that can be used to determine the optimal staking percentage based on the expected return and probability of success. However, the Kelly criterion can be sensitive to errors in the estimated probabilities, so it's important to use it with caution.

It’s typically wise to limit the amount of capital risked on any single event. Setting a maximum loss threshold per prediction, or per period of time, can help to protect capital during losing streaks. Regularly reviewing and adjusting the staking plan based on performance is also important. A flexible staking plan that adapts to changing market conditions and individual performance can enhance long-term profitability.
